• Care Home
  • Care home

Meadow View Care Home

Overall: Good read more about inspection ratings

80 High Street, Irchester, Wellingborough, Northamptonshire, NN29 7AB (01933) 355111

Provided and run by:
Wellbeing Care Limited

Important: The provider of this service changed. See old profile